Detalles del Curso


โ€ข Literature of Inequality: An Introduction
โ€ข Understanding Social and Economic Inequality
โ€ข The Power of Literature in Depicting Inequality
โ€ข Inequality in Classic Literature: A Study
โ€ข Contemporary Literature and Modern Inequality
โ€ข Literature of Race and Ethnicity: An Examination
โ€ข Gender Inequality in Literature: Exploring the Themes
โ€ข Literature and Income Inequality: The Wealth Gap
โ€ข The Role of Literature in Building Awareness of Inequality
โ€ข Strategies for Teaching Literature of Inequality
